My name is Mannie & I'm twenty-one years young. I'm more graceful in water than on my own two feet.

I grew up in the water, but started swimming competitively when I was seven. I swam for a club team and also, when I started high school, I swam for that team, too. After I graduated (2006) I wasn't able to find a good, local masters team to join; All the ones around me were 80 year olds swimming to stay healthy... I still wanted to compete! This is when I basically stopped swimming. I tried to stick with it (going to lap swim & coaching myself) but between two jobs, six days a week it was tough. In late July 2008 I moved about two hours away from home (Mount Dora, FL) to live with my boyfriend of almost four years while he attends class in Tampa at the University of South Florida. My boyfriend & I really tried to stay fit (using our apartment complex exercise room) but we just couldn't keep to it. My boyfriend, Austin, has joined in starting up a crew (rowing) club for USF. They have workout meetings on campus and I've decided to go along and swim while he's in the gym.

It feels amazing to be back in the pool! I'm all hooked again, so I've created this blog! I plan to track & share my workouts, share my favorite healthy recipes (I'm vegetarian, but Austin isn't, so I'll share some meat recipes, too), talk about swimming techniques, and answer any and all questions you readers may have!
